Taking North Korea at Its Word

Taking North Korea at Its Word

So long as the West remains unaware of just how different divided Korea is from divided Germany, it will continue misjudging and mispredicting the North’s behavior. Unification is the only plausible goal big enough to make sense of the enormous sums of money the country continues investing in its nuclear and ballistic program — and losing through sanctions as a result.
